For example, an issue can either be put on the policy agenda or not put on the agenda. At the decision phase, the decision can be for or against policy reform. At any of the three stages, a policy either continues to move toward successful implementation, or else it is derailed. A third type of policy model is described in terms of policy streams. Kingdon (1984) suggests that policy change comes about when three streams—problems, politics, and policies—connect. Howlett (2011) subdivides it in terms of agenda setting, policy formulation, decision making, implementation and evaluation. In general, Top-down implementation is the carrying out of a policy decision—by statute, executive order, or court decision; whereas the authoritative decisions are “centrally located” by actors who seek to produce the “desired effects” (Matland, 1995, 146).
